Ben Pfaff a11fdef12e Revert "json: New function json_serialized_length()."
This reverts commit 1600fa6853.

Connections that queue up too much data, because they are monitoring a
table that is changing quickly and failing to keep up with the updates,
cause problems with buffer management.  Since commit 60533a405b
(jsonrpc-server: Disconnect connections that queue too much data.),
ovsdb-server has dealt with them by disconnecting the connection and
letting them start up again with a fresh copy of the database.  However,
this is not ideal because of situations where disconnection happens
repeatedly.  For example:

     - A manager toggles a column back and forth between two or more values
       quickly (in which case the data transmitted over the monitoring
       connections always increases quickly, without bound).

     - A manager repeatedly extends the contents of some column in some row
       (in which case the data transmitted over the monitoring connection
       grows with O(n**2) in the length of the string).

A better way to deal with this problem is to combine updates when they are
sent to the monitoring connection, if that connection is not keeping up.
In both the above cases, this reduces the data that must be sent to a
manageable amount.  An upcoming patch implements this new way.  This commit
reverts part of the previous solution that disconnects backlogged
connections, since it is no longer useful.

#ifndef JSON_H
#define JSON_H 1
/* This is an implementation of JavaScript Object Notation (JSON) as specified
* by RFC 4627. It is intended to fully comply with RFC 4627, with the
* following known exceptions and clarifications:
*
* - Null bytes (\u0000) are not allowed in strings.
*
* - Only UTF-8 encoding is supported (RFC 4627 allows for other Unicode
* encodings).
*
* - Names within an object must be unique (RFC 4627 says that they
* "should" be unique).
*/
#include "shash.h"
#ifdef __cplusplus
extern "C" {
#endif
struct ds;
/* Type of a JSON value. */
enum json_type {
JSON_NULL, /* null */
JSON_FALSE, /* false */
JSON_TRUE, /* true */
JSON_OBJECT, /* {"a": b, "c": d, ...} */
JSON_ARRAY, /* [1, 2, 3, ...] */
JSON_INTEGER, /* 123. */
JSON_REAL, /* 123.456. */
JSON_STRING, /* "..." */
JSON_N_TYPES
};
const char *json_type_to_string(enum json_type);
/* A JSON array. */
struct json_array {
size_t n, n_allocated;
struct json **elems;
};
/* A JSON value. */
struct json {
enum json_type type;
union {
struct shash *object; /* Contains "struct json *"s. */
struct json_array array;
long long int integer;
double real;
char *string;
} u;
};
struct json *json_null_create(void);
struct json *json_boolean_create(bool);
struct json *json_string_create(const char *);
struct json *json_string_create_nocopy(char *);
struct json *json_integer_create(long long int);
struct json *json_real_create(double);
struct json *json_array_create_empty(void);
void json_array_add(struct json *, struct json *element);
void json_array_trim(struct json *);
struct json *json_array_create(struct json **, size_t n);
struct json *json_array_create_1(struct json *);
struct json *json_array_create_2(struct json *, struct json *);
struct json *json_array_create_3(struct json *, struct json *, struct json *);
struct json *json_object_create(void);
void json_object_put(struct json *, const char *name, struct json *value);
void json_object_put_string(struct json *,
const char *name, const char *value);
const char *json_string(const struct json *);
struct json_array *json_array(const struct json *);
struct shash *json_object(const struct json *);
bool json_boolean(const struct json *);
double json_real(const struct json *);
int64_t json_integer(const struct json *);
struct json *json_clone(const struct json *);
void json_destroy(struct json *);
size_t json_hash(const struct json *, size_t basis);
bool json_equal(const struct json *, const struct json *);
/* Parsing JSON. */
enum {
JSPF_TRAILER = 1 << 0 /* Check for garbage following input. */
};
struct json_parser *json_parser_create(int flags);
size_t json_parser_feed(struct json_parser *, const char *, size_t);
bool json_parser_is_done(const struct json_parser *);
struct json *json_parser_finish(struct json_parser *);
void json_parser_abort(struct json_parser *);
struct json *json_from_string(const char *string);
struct json *json_from_file(const char *file_name);
struct json *json_from_stream(FILE *stream);
/* Serializing JSON. */
enum {
JSSF_PRETTY = 1 << 0, /* Multiple lines with indentation, if true. */
JSSF_SORT = 1 << 1 /* Object members in sorted order, if true. */
};
char *json_to_string(const struct json *, int flags);
void json_to_ds(const struct json *, int flags, struct ds *);
/* JSON string formatting operations. */
bool json_string_unescape(const char *in, size_t in_len, char **outp);
#ifdef __cplusplus
}
#endif
#endif /* json.h */
